Jason Ramsay
|
1f9bdef0fb
|
RulesProvider performance improvements
|
2017-04-24 17:32:02 -07:00 |
|
Andy Hanson
|
455492d887
|
Merge branch 'master' into fallthrough
|
2017-04-18 09:48:21 -07:00 |
|
Andy Hanson
|
c7d51a3053
|
Merge branch 'master' into refactor_findallrefs
|
2017-04-12 11:27:58 -07:00 |
|
Andy Hanson
|
a82ac45e36
|
Merge branch 'master' into fallthrough
|
2017-04-12 10:58:03 -07:00 |
|
Andy Hanson
|
ed5eca2b7b
|
boolean-trivia lint rule: Enforce space between comment and argument
|
2017-04-11 09:44:58 -07:00 |
|
Andy Hanson
|
73cab09608
|
Enable jsdoc-format lint rule
|
2017-04-03 14:39:19 -07:00 |
|
Mine Starks
|
af0b2d9768
|
Merge pull request #12856 from minestarks/includejsdoctags
Expose JSDoc tags through the language service
|
2017-03-31 17:58:41 -07:00 |
|
Mohamed Hegazy
|
8ea961714b
|
Merge remote-tracking branch 'origin/master' into checkJSFiles
|
2017-03-27 21:23:26 -07:00 |
|
Andy Hanson
|
1cf765d664
|
Lint for fallthrough in switch
|
2017-03-27 15:09:00 -07:00 |
|
Jason Ramsay
|
d20cebf998
|
Merge branch 'master' into CancellationChecksForLowPriorityTasks
|
2017-03-27 14:49:41 -07:00 |
|
Andy Hanson
|
aa1c860f08
|
Merge branch 'master' into refactor_findallrefs
|
2017-03-27 11:31:07 -07:00 |
|
Mohamed Hegazy
|
e408cad618
|
Merge branch 'master' into checkJSFiles
|
2017-03-22 15:45:27 -07:00 |
|
Andy
|
18f0d85bff
|
Merge pull request #14581 from Microsoft/foreachchild
Expose `forEachChild` as a method of Node
|
2017-03-20 14:56:21 -07:00 |
|
Andy Hanson
|
ec558b8080
|
Merge branch 'master' into refactor_findallrefs
|
2017-03-17 08:04:04 -07:00 |
|
Zhengbo Li
|
5040e1d279
|
Mark occurence item in string with a special property (#14677)
* mark occurence item in string with a special property
* Adding trailing commas
|
2017-03-16 11:01:48 -07:00 |
|
Mohamed Hegazy
|
0dac29f6f3
|
Merge branch 'master' into checkJSFiles
|
2017-03-15 12:35:26 -07:00 |
|
Vladimir Matveev
|
2b10611fbf
|
initial revision of infrastructure to produce text changes that uses existing node factory, formatter and printer (#14441)
initial revision of infrastructure to produce text changes that uses existing node factory, formatter and printer
|
2017-03-15 11:44:36 -07:00 |
|
Andy Hanson
|
746b7e4798
|
Expose forEachChild as a method of Node
|
2017-03-10 10:42:26 -08:00 |
|
Mohamed Hegazy
|
3d03f8d8a5
|
Merge branch 'fixBuildBreak' into checkJSFiles
|
2017-03-08 23:17:28 -08:00 |
|
Mohamed Hegazy
|
b015c1d9b0
|
Allow @check directives to switch on/off checking in a file
|
2017-03-06 21:39:32 -08:00 |
|
Mohamed Hegazy
|
9f0c5ce141
|
Add support for //@check directives
|
2017-03-06 13:50:27 -08:00 |
|
Andy Hanson
|
8371eb6401
|
Update tslint to latest (next is still on 4.3) and lint for BOM
|
2017-03-01 10:37:13 -08:00 |
|
Andy Hanson
|
aac3d80fc4
|
Merge branch 'master' into refactor_findallrefs
|
2017-03-01 08:45:41 -08:00 |
|
andy-ms
|
c2f4b202a4
|
Add more specific return type for getTypeParameters()
|
2017-02-26 17:48:27 -08:00 |
|
Jason Ramsay
|
21ef9078ad
|
Wrapping LSHost's cancellationtoken with a throttle
|
2017-02-24 17:14:04 -08:00 |
|
Jason Ramsay
|
e62108cf9b
|
Removing throttling until tests prove it is required
|
2017-02-22 17:47:18 -08:00 |
|
Jason Ramsay
|
a37053f780
|
Addressing CR comments
- Adding a throttle
- Refactor
- Navbar reset onCancel
|
2017-02-22 14:23:06 -08:00 |
|
Jason Ramsay
|
3f198e6751
|
Adding cancellation token checks for lower priority tasks
|
2017-02-21 13:30:55 -08:00 |
|
Ron Buckton
|
0f495fb694
|
Merge branch 'strictNullFactories' into publicTransformers
|
2017-02-16 12:41:58 -08:00 |
|
Andy Hanson
|
42a832ad3d
|
Refactor findAllReferences. Now supports renamed exports and imports.
|
2017-02-16 06:48:00 -08:00 |
|
Yui
|
ca6f1c3a41
|
Merge pull request #13640 from Microsoft/wip-master-statelessOverload
Using overload to figure out function signature for SFC
|
2017-02-15 07:17:32 -08:00 |
|
Ron Buckton
|
23216f9ba1
|
Merge branch 'master' into genericDefaults
|
2017-02-14 19:19:18 -08:00 |
|
Kanchalai Tanglertsampan
|
e5cfe5c348
|
Merge branch 'master' into wip-master-statelessOverload
# Conflicts:
# src/compiler/factory.ts
|
2017-02-14 15:21:06 -08:00 |
|
Arthur Ozga
|
6c2c2f8f3f
|
use deduplicate
|
2017-02-14 11:30:19 -08:00 |
|
Arthur Ozga
|
21355982fd
|
Offer missing abstract codefix once
* per class that is missing potentially many abstract members.
|
2017-02-13 16:58:14 -08:00 |
|
Ron Buckton
|
cd22d81c67
|
Merge branch 'master' into publicTransformers
|
2017-02-09 15:44:51 -08:00 |
|
Ron Buckton
|
2f624f5df3
|
Expose transformations as public API
|
2017-02-07 14:36:15 -08:00 |
|
Kanchalai Tanglertsampan
|
42c0816164
|
Merge branch 'master' into wip-master-statelessOverload
|
2017-01-31 11:33:07 -08:00 |
|
Andy Hanson
|
8515f7e2b5
|
Change find-all-references tests to test for groups
* Also always test for isWriteAccess and isDefinition
|
2017-01-31 06:59:16 -08:00 |
|
Ron Buckton
|
b58ef9e932
|
Merge branch 'master' into genericDefaults
|
2017-01-30 14:32:00 -08:00 |
|
Andy
|
65125791d2
|
Merge pull request #13643 from Microsoft/find_all_refs_default
Support find-all-references for default exports
|
2017-01-26 10:33:17 -08:00 |
|
Kanchalai Tanglertsampan
|
3e07398aee
|
Merge branch 'master' into wip-master-statelessOverload
|
2017-01-24 14:18:39 -08:00 |
|
Andy Hanson
|
e8c3d548eb
|
Fix tests
|
2017-01-24 12:56:21 -08:00 |
|
Nathan Shively-Sanders
|
053b3cd893
|
getFirstToken skips JSDoc
Fixes #13519.
This is a better fix than #13599.
Also fixes broken tests associated with #13599.
|
2017-01-23 16:01:29 -08:00 |
|
Anders Hejlsberg
|
5b9004e1bc
|
Merge pull request #13604 from Microsoft/intersectionBaseTypes
Allow deriving from object and intersection types
|
2017-01-21 11:38:24 -10:00 |
|
Ron Buckton
|
76ba6a7f6a
|
Merge branch 'master' into genericDefaults
|
2017-01-20 20:37:35 -08:00 |
|
Mohamed Hegazy
|
9ac7c322b5
|
Merge pull request #13599 from Microsoft/getFirstToken-returns-jsdoc
getFirstToken returns jsdoc as single comment
|
2017-01-20 17:01:02 -08:00 |
|
Nathan Shively-Sanders
|
1183129bda
|
getFirstToken returns jsdoc as single comment
This is a bit odd, but it's the way that 2.0 and earlier behaved. 2.1
broke it.
|
2017-01-20 10:17:11 -08:00 |
|
Andy Hanson
|
1267fd3030
|
Don't use nameTable for type keywords, and don't handle keyof.
|
2017-01-20 06:41:57 -08:00 |
|
Anders Hejlsberg
|
a6c5306479
|
Allow object intersection types as class/interface base types
|
2017-01-19 13:58:09 -08:00 |
|